    3 wheel baby stroller Wheeler Pushchairs From Birth

    baby-jogger-city-mini-gt2-all-terrain-pushchair-lightweight-foldable-stroller-briar-green-1081.jpgThis jogger pushchair is safe from birth and has large all-terrain tires that are ideal for rough terrain. It is recommended to look for models with a lockable wheel on the front, or that are compatible with car seats, second-seats, buggy board and car seats.

    With a sturdy frame and hard-wearing wheels, it's ideal for outdoor adventures, and comes with great storage options to add to it!

    Frames made of solid wood

    The sturdy frames on 3 wheeler buggies as well as pushchairs make them durable and long-lasting. They are also more stable than pushchairs with four wheels and buggies, which means your baby or toddler can rest easy on a long stroll or outing with you. You can choose from a wide selection of three wheeler prams that are suitable for infants up to toddlers. If you choose a single 3 wheel buggy or a double pushchair these models can offer a variety of recline positions as your baby develops and will come with fantastic storage solutions too.

    All-terrain pushchairs are a great option for outdoor enthusiasts and those looking to take their family out on sandy or muddy excursions. They feature extra-large front and rear wheels, as well as suspension systems that ensure your child's safety. They are often fitted with additional features such as an adjustable handlebar, a handbrake and a handbrake to provide comfort and convenience.

    Joggers and strollers are two more popular models of 3 wheeler pushchairs. Strollers have a smaller and lighter frame, which allows them to be more maneuverable in urban areas. They can be folded and put in the boot of your car for a quick walk to the shop or a trip around the park. Joggers are designed for active parents and are built to let you jog or even run with your child. They have larger and wider wheels to tackle uneven surfaces. They also come with a harness and seat adjustments to ensure your child's safety and comfort.

    The 3 wheel buggies are lightweight and compact, which makes them a great choice for busy parents. They are less likely to topple over than four-wheeled buggies and can be pulled with one hand, if needed. They don't have the same amount of storage space as a standard buggy or stroller due to their triangular frames. You may want to consider a four-wheeled pushchair if you frequently go shopping or need to navigate narrow aisles or bustling city streets regularly.

    Easy to maneuver

    Typically, they are designed with two wheels larger at the back and one smaller wheel in the front three-wheel pushchairs can maneuver in a way that four-wheeled models can't. This makes them ideal for busy streets and shops where you must be capable of turning and making turns quickly and effortlessly. They are also great for off-road adventures due to the single wheel on the front lets them handle bumps and gravel with ease.

    If you opt for a 3 wheel pushchairs wheeler pushchair, ensure it is fitted with air-filled tyres as well as puncture-proof materials. This will help keep the buggy in good condition, making it much easier for you and your child to travel on any terrain. This will help maintain the weight of the stroller and ensure it doesn't topple over.

    Another thing to think about when selecting a 3 wheel baby strollers wheeler pushchair (his response) is whether it will be suitable for babies. Choose a model that has an auto-reclining seat that can accommodate a car or carrycot seat from birth. It's also worth checking if it will fold and unfold without much effort, since this can be a big help when you're on the go.

    Make sure your buggy has a reversible handle. This allows you to alter the direction in which the handle is facing to suit your preference. This can be particularly useful if you're going to be using it on cobbles, grass or dirt tracks that aren't suited to standard pushchairs.

    A 3-wheeler can be an ideal choice if you're looking for a pushchair to take you and your child out for jogging. It'll come with XL air-filled tires and suspension to cope with a variety of surfaces. Some models have a lockable and swiveling front wheel that is ideal for running on hard surfaces. Some jogging pushchairs are suited starting at birth when used in conjunction with a compatible carrycot or car seat However, you should wait until your baby is at least 6 or 9 months old before attempting to run with them.

    Easy to clean

    It's important to clean your pushchair regularly to avoid the formation of stains, mud, and mould growth. This will ensure that it looks as fresh as new and operating as efficiently as it can for as long as you can. Keep your pushchair in great condition by giving it a quick wash every week, and a thorough clean every month.

    Begin by assessing the amount of dirt, mud and mould in order to identify areas that require attention. It will be easier to clean if you use a soft-bristled tooth brush to clean dirt or dried mud from fabrics, such as the seat and basket.     After you've cleaned the surfaces of your stroller, it's time to clean the wheels. The wheels of your stroller, no matter if they're made of rubber or plastic will be more filthy than other areas due to the fact that they are in direct contact with the floor. It is recommended to begin by cleaning the wheels. You can use a scourer to remove the marks that are stubborn. However, you should avoid scratching the chassis frame surface, as this could lead to rust.

    You must then wash the wheels thoroughly with clean water and allow them to dry completely before reattaching them to the chassis frame. Be sure to consult your user's manual to see whether the manufacturer suggests that you lubricate the wheel bearings on a regular basis.

    The problem of mould is a concern for many parents as it not only looks unattractive, but it could also release spores which are harmful to your child. Therefore, it is important to take action immediately when you notice it and take action with an anti-mould solution like white vinegar. This will break down bacteria and lift the stain off of the fabric, leaving the surface clean. If you're lucky enough, your mould-removal solution will leave your stroller smelling fresh and clean!

    Fantastic storage

    All-terrain pushchairs are an excellent choice for parents who love going out with their children and want to be able to navigate rough terrain. They typically come with large rear wheels, great suspension and can be used on pavements or roads that are paved.

    These pushchairs are also known to have a lot of storage options. For instance they usually come with large baskets and pockets inside the hood. They're usually designed to be simple to fold, with certain models able to be folded by one hand.

    However, it's important to keep in mind that the massive rear wheels can make these pushchairs a little larger than standard buggies, which might mean they're suitable for small cars or narrow aisles in the supermarket. They can also be quite heavy and bulky when folded, which is why they have to be taken into consideration when lifting it into your car boot or up a flight of stairs is something you'll need to do frequently.

    MFM reviewer Kath put the iCandy Core through its paces and found that it was able "to navigate through cobbles, grass and dirt tracks effortlessly, and I could easily go up and over kerbs". The Core can also be used as a jogger after your baby is old enough to use its rear facing 3 wheel stroller wheels that measure 16 inches and lockable swivel front wheels. The tyres are foam-filled never-flat which means you'll only need to pump them occasionally and they've got built-in suspension to help your child have fun on the road.

    Mountain Buggy Ridge is another excellent option. It comes with a variety of fantastic features making it a great all-terrain stroller from birth. It can be used with a carrycot, has a lie-flat seating position and can be used from birth. You can also expand with your child by using a toddler or infant carrier. It comes with a fantastic suspension system, large air-filled tires that can be pumped using a single button press, technical water-resistant fabric and an easy-to-use brake with one hand.
